Kia-Motors-New-2021.pngSigns that your door lock actuator power is not functioning properly

The actuator could be the reason that your door locks that are powered by electricity don't work. The actuator may be damaged through corrosion or rust. The cause of corrosion is the ingress of moisture and oil into the actuator's mechanical connections and making them weaker. This results in a faulty actuator.

If the door locks don't open or close, you may need to replace the actuator. An actuator that isn't working properly can cause loud and annoying sounds, and can cause problems over the long term. The most common symptom of a defective power door lock actuator is a loud noise from the inside of the door. This is due to the fact that the motor and gears of the actuator work in conjunction.

One of the most effective methods to identify a power door lock actuator problem is to determine whether power is supplied to the actuator. This will help you determine the cause. A defective power door lock actuator will also cause your power door locks act in a different way. Remove the door's panel using safety glasses and examine the actuator.

The wiring harness that connects the actuator may be frayed as well. If this is the case, you can seek advice from the dealership on how to replace the actuator. In certain cases, a local garage can help with the troubleshooting. If you're having issues with your power door lock actuator, it's best to seek out professional help.

The door locks may be locked or unlocked suddenly if the actuator for the door lock fails. These are potentially dangerous situations for car central lock remote repair owners. If the lock actuator isn't working correctly, the door open warning light will continue to turn on even if the doors are closed. The warning lamp for the door is part of the lock assembly. Damaged parts can cause it to malfunction.

Intermittent power door lock operation is the most common issue caused by a defective actuator. In many cases, the driver is able to observe the lock moving but it isn't able to disengage. The actuator is an integral part of the latch assembly, and its failure will require replacing the entire assembly.

A blown fuse is a different reason for a defective power door lock actuator. A fuse that is blown will stop the electrical current needed by the actuator from flowing. A defective door lock actuator could cause an alarm to be activated. This happens when water seeps into the connector in the event of rain. The connector should be sealed to resolve the issue.

A bad power door lock actuator can render your power door locks useless. If this happens your door locks with power will stop working properly and your doors may get stuck. You may have to unlock them manually. You might also hear an unusual sound when you unlock your door.

If the door lock actuator has failed you must replace it as soon as possible. The actuator could be located in the door latch assembly, based on your vehicle's model. Older vehicles may have separate actuators. Sometimes, the actuator could be distinct from the latch and secured with screws or clips made of plastic. You'll need to remove the door panel from the actuator along with the lock assembly.

Repair costs for a defective actuator

An actuator for the door lock in your vehicle that is not working properly can lead to various issues. It is possible that the door won't unlock or it's making strange noises. You'll have to take your car to a mechanic in these situations. While repairing a damaged actuator is costly but it can also enhance the comfort of your vehicle.

An average cost to replace an actuator that is malfunctioning in an automotive door lock is $120 to $290. This amount varies depending on the model and the make of the vehicle. You should expect to spend between $400 and $500 to replace the door actuator in your Audi. If you're replacing an actuator in the form of a Ferrari or Porsche, the cost will be more.
